The 2020 Yamaha WR is significantly more reliable than average, with an 89.4% first-time pass rate well above the UK's 80% benchmark. Dangerous defects are rare at just 6.5%, so safety concerns shouldn't deter a buyer considering this model.
These bikes are still young with modest mileage—a median of 1,587 miles suggests many haven't been heavily used—and they're backing that up with minimal failures (0.36 per vehicle) despite averaging 1.3 advisories. Before purchasing, check the specific bike's service history and have any advisories professionally assessed, as even low-mileage machines can develop issues if maintenance has been neglected.

Mileage Distribution
Most 2020 Yamaha Wr vehicles sit in the blue band. If the vehicle you're looking at is outside it, it's either unusually low or high mileage for its age.
Half of all 2020 Yamaha Wr vehicles fall between 796 and 2,897 miles.
